10.2  Loudness and Pitch of Sound
   
  • The loudness of sound produced depends on the amplitude of the sound wave
  • Pitch of sound depends on the frequency of the sound produced
  • Frequency is measured in the unit of hertz (Hz)

The relationship between loudness and amplitude

  • When wave amplitude increases, louder sound is produced

The relationship between pitch of a sound and frequency

  • When wave frequency increases, higher pitch is produced

Doppler Effect

  • The Doppler effect is the apparent change in frequency caused by the relative movement of sound source, the relative movement of the observer or both.
